The State of Education - Four Headteachers Give Their Views

The Conservative Education Society is honoured to welcome four experienced and successful headteachers, who will talk through their experiences of the highlights and challenges facing education leaders, as well as their assessment of what they would like to see from the new Government.

The meeting will take place at the Palace of Westminster.  Exact room details will be released to ticket-holders only.  

We will be welcoming:

Evelyn Forde MBE, Headteacher, Copthall School; Former TES Head Teacher of the Year; President, Association of School and College Leaders

Marina Gardiner-Legge, Headteacher, Oxford High School GDST; President Elect of the Girls Schools' Association

Dr. Clare Rees, Executive Headteacher, Havelock Primary School; Principal Quality Partnership Lead (3-11), Ealing Council

Clare Wagner, Headteacher, The Henrietta Barnett School; Head of Communications, The Conservative Education Society
